    The Ultimate Guide to Finding the Perfect Student Apartment

    Choosing the right living space can make or break your college experience. Students not only seek comfort but also accessibility to campus, safety, and affordability in a student apartment. With so many options available, it can often feel overwhelming.

    Knowing what to prioritize and how to navigate the housing market can help you find the apartment that suits your unique needs. Keep on reading for more info on student living.

    Understanding What You Need

    Your first step in the search for your ideal student apartment is to identify your non-negotiables. Do you require a studio, or are you open to sharing accommodations with roommates? Consider the following factors:

    • Location
    • Budget
    • Amenities

    Each of these aspects plays a crucial role in determining your overall satisfaction, so take the time to assess your requirements thoroughly.

    Setting a Budget

    Financial considerations are undeniably important when searching for a student apartment. Many students rely on financial aid or part-time jobs to cover expenses. Aim to spend no more than 30% of your monthly income on rent. This approach helps you avoid financial stress and allows you to allocate funds for other necessities such as textbooks, food, and activities.

    Additionally, don’t forget to factor in other costs like utilities, which can range anywhere from $50 to $200, depending on your usage and the apartment’s location. Be thorough and consider hidden costs!

    Exploring Rental Options

    Use a variety of platforms to locate available apartments. Websites such as Zillow, Apartments.com, and dedicated college housing services are excellent starting points. Local classifieds and social media groups can also yield beneficial leads. If you’re in a college town, buildings intentionally marketed toward students often provide better terms, such as flexible lease lengths.

    Visit Potential Apartments

    Once you’ve narrowed down your options, schedule visits to potential apartments. Seeing the space in person can help you determine if it meets your expectations. During your visit, pay attention to the following:

    • General cleanliness and maintenance
    • Noisy neighbors and overall noise levels
    • Safety features such as secure locks and lighting

    This assessment will provide you with a better understanding of the living conditions, allowing for a more informed decision.

    Signing the Lease

    Once you find a suitable student apartment, ensure you read the lease carefully. Look for clauses regarding entry notices, maintenance responsibilities, and policies on subletting or bringing pets. If something seems unclear, don’t hesitate to ask questions or negotiate terms that better suit your needs.
